On the step where you add oil to the diff cups, the manual says the diff cup assembly weighs 9.80g but both of mine weighed 9.63g. It wanted me to add 1.32g of oil per assembly but the oil covered the cross arms when I got to 10.75g, which is a lot less oil. (I know that 0.2g doesn't sound like a lot of oil but it really is!) I suspect that not overfilling the diff cups is pretty important so do you think I did the right thing?
The weighing thing is kind of useless unless I am just doing it wrong. (Just breathing on the scale makes it change!)

tech tip : Rather than take out the 2 swaybar screws I loosened the setscrew on the swaybar adjuster and slipped it off, the gearbox stayed on the sway bar.

So far people have had issues with:
Composite diff gear breaking
Carbon tower breaking
Diff housing tearing apart
Drive shaft pins pushing out of the plastic holder
Shocks leaking
BUT! Some people doesn't have had any issues at all.
What category I'll be in will be decided on saturday
Maybe Xray have made rod ends that are a bit too awesome. I rather see rod ends pop than having other parts break. I mean that it's better if a marshal can snap the car together than loosing the whole heat. Yes, I personally see them as fuses.
